Pride Festival 2026 at Auckland Art Gallery Toi o Tāmaki
Celebrate Pride at Auckland Art Gallery Toi o Tāmaki with a day of art, music, performance and self-expression. This festival brings together rainbow artists and communities in a joyful programme honouring creativity, identity and connection.

Programme highlights:

• Buckwheat – Our fabulous hostess will be with us all day to emcee the event!
• Jason Parker – A high-energy pop performance from one of Aotearoa’s rising stars
• GALS (Gay and Lesbian Singers) – Uplifting choral music from this iconic community choir
• Gertrude Stein and a Companion – A theatrical performance exploring Queer love, art collecting and legacy
• Pride Patches: Stitch Your Style! – Craft your identity onto your own clothes or design a shirt using upcycled Gallery uniforms.

Expect surprise pop-ups, music and plenty of colour throughout the day.
